Step 4: Configure connection pooling for the Larkfield reporting database. Set the pool size to 20 and idle timeout to 300 seconds in pool.toml. Values above 25 have caused exhaustion on the shared Quellside cluster, so do not raise them casually. Before restarting the service, register the deploy key shown below.

rollout seal: bky4_x7Gc

Subject: Proctorline queue key rotation — action tonight

On-call: we're rotating the ingest key for the Proctorline exam-proctoring queue at 02:00. The old key stops working immediately after cutover. Update the worker config on both queue nodes, restart `proctor-ingest`, and confirm messages drain in the Skyledger dashboard. Expect a brief backlog; anything over ten minutes, page the platform lead. Verification steps are in the runbook under "Queue Rotation." The new key is below.

gateway credential: zpat15_lMLOSdhT94y0U3l

Reseller Programme — Branch Managers Only

The Vintrell reseller programme launches next quarter. Three tiers; margins set centrally. Branch responsibilities: local vetting, onboarding within ten days, quarterly performance returns. No discounting beyond tier schedule. Pilot branches: Aldcombe and Merrow Heath. Full rollout contingent on pilot results. Do not circulate outside management. The confidential note on associated business plans appears directly below.

board note of yadup-fajef: Druiusox Holdings is in early talks to buy Norwynek Systems for about $186.0 million. The Kaseth launch date is June 24, and nothing goes to the press before then. Legal wants the Quenethek Group term sheet withdrawn before November 27.

Ticket: Staging env misconfigured for Siftgate bloom filter

The bloom layer in front of the Pellet KV store is rejecting all lookups in staging because the env file was copied from the dev template without credentials. False-positive tuning values are fine; only the auth line is missing. To unblock the weekly demo, the Pellet admission secret must be set on the following line.

env line for yaguf-fajop: LEDGER_TOKEN13=fb08984397349